Historically, Hamilton College has evolved its calendar to reflect changing educational needs. Founded in 1793 as Hamilton-Oneida Academy and chartered as Hamilton College in 1812, the institution has a rich tradition of adapting to broader societal shifts. For instance, in the early 20th century, calendars were adjusted to accommodate agricultural cycles in rural New York, emphasizing breaks that allowed students to assist with harvests. Today, the calendar emphasizes mental health and work-life balance, incorporating mid-semester pauses that help mitigate burnout. Compared to larger universities, Hamilton's smaller size allows for a more personalized approach, with flexible scheduling that accommodates individual student needs, such as independent studies or off-campus research.
